Interior Designing can be challenging especially when there are varied age groups and Interests in a family. The Natures Fable design was intended to be visually appealing while still being practical for everyday use of the Master and his family – the elderly ones and his children. Nature’s Fable is an Apartment inspired by the theme biophilia. The Grand Parents have been given a crucial safety consideration by optimizing the corners, and providing slip-resistant floor finishes.

Creating a cohesive design that appeals to all age groups while maintaining a consistent aesthetic throughout the space is another challenge. The client’s brief talked about a mix of contemporary style and greens to create a space that feels modern and innovative while also promoting a sense of connection to nature.
The living and the Dining spaces emphasizes clean lines, minimalism, and neutral colors to create elegance, as much as the natural elements like wood, plants, and natural light to create a calming and organic feel.
Successful fusion of these two styles resulted in creating a sense of harmony, where neither style dominates but instead complement each other.
Layered lighting, including overhead lights and lamps, can create a warm and inviting atmosphere that balances the clean lines of the contemporary aesthetic.
Overall, natures Fable is a successful contemporary-biophilic fusion with a cohesive and balanced feel, subtle colors, and a connection to nature.
The crockery display unit near the dining space was inspired, experimented and was successfully executed in an unusual way. The idea was to create a more playful and modular display unit with a hook detail in the fixing of the wooden joinery.
All the boxes, both open and closed, can be moved to any side of the mirror in the center both horizontally and vertically.
These combinations in the arrangement of the boxes provide different perceptions of the unit and can be a unique layout every time the user needs it.
The design showcases a modern looking living cum dining space with a classical touch by creating a layered environment with textures, patterns, and colors. A panelled wall in earthen tones and a Console table in white Brick texture wall opposite to it constitutes to the classical touch of the space along with brass detailed centre table and lights.
The design of the kitchen shouts modernity with the countertop and the back splash made in black granite complimenting the light-colored modular wooden cabinets, adding to the warmth required for the mood of the space.
The wall adjacent to the kitchen counter is made as a visual delight with pinewood fluting and profile lights providing a bit of space for the special décor to be placed.
Connection with Nature in the Interior environments is the driving concept, driven by our interpretation of the client’s expressed needs and desires. Four underlying zones of nature – Water, Earth, Sky, and Forest are used to weave the spaces of the apartment.
The Master bedroom portrays earthen elegance with tones of brown on wooden flooring.
The grandparent’s bedroom as per client’s requirement is designed to have an indirect visual connection with nature through making it a space with playful green colors and natural plants.
The client’s requirement for each space was diverse like having a Modern styled living room with a touch of Classical emphasis elements, an elderly Bedroom close to the nature, and a vibrant and energetic bedroom for his young girls.
